Abiraterone Acetate and its Role in Oncology

Abiraterone acetate plays the role of a synthetic steroid hormone inhibitor commonly utilized in the treatment against advanced prostate cancer. It works by blocking an enzyme known as 17-alpha-hydroxylase, which contributes to the production by testosterone. By inhibiting this enzyme, abiraterone acetate reduces testosterone levels systemically, thus slowing or stopping the growth of prostate cancer cells.

, As a result, abiraterone acetate is often administered to combination therapy with other medications, including prednisone and cytotoxic agents. It has demonstrated effectiveness for patients with castration-resistant prostate cancer, offering a valuable treatment option extend survival rates and life expectancy.

Comprehending the CAS Numbers for Pharmaceutical Compounds

CAS Numbers are essential identifiers used in the pharmaceutical industry to distinctly identify chemical substances. These digital codes, assigned by the Chemical Abstracts Service (CAS), provide a consistent system for translating information about pharmaceutical elements globally. By employing CAS Numbers, researchers, manufacturers, and regulators can effectively obtain critical data on a compound's properties, safety profile, and intended applications.
